12. Chain lubrication
12.1 Pickup body
Impurities gradually clog the fine
pores of the filter with minute
particles of dirt. This prevents the oil
pump from supplying sufficient oil to
the bar and chain. Always check the
oil tank and pick-up body first if
problems develop in the oil supply.
– Troubleshooting, b 3.3
– Unscrew oil tank cap and drain oil
tank
– Collect oil in a clean container,
b 1
– Clean the oil tank if necessary,
b 16
: Pull pick-up body (1) out of oil
tank with assembly hook (2)
5910 893 8800
Take care not to overextend the
suction hose.
– Pull off pickup body (1) and
examine it, replace if necessary
– Reassemble parts in reverse
order

12.2 Oil suction hose
– Unscrew oil tank cap and drain oil
tank, b 1
– Remove the clutch, b 4.2
– Remove brake band, b 5.2
– Remove oil pump, b 12.3
: Pry out oil suction hose (1) and
pull it out with pickup body
– Examine oil suction hose and
pick-up body, replace if
necessary
– Fit the pickup body, b 12.1
Installation
– Coat groove of oil suction hose
with STIHL press fluid, b 16
: Push oil suction hose (1) through
opening in housing with the pick-
up body first

: Orient oil suction hose (1) so that
the straight sides (arrows) rest
against the crankcase
: Push in oil suction hose (1) until
the groove is completely flush
with the hole in the crankcase
– Check position of pick-up body,
clear it with the aid of assembly
hook 5910 893 8800 if necessary
– Install oil pump, b 12.3
– Reassemble remaining parts in
reverse order
